Deciphering the mystery of the heraldry availability of the Hashanova lineage

Exclusivity and legitimacy in the granting of heraldry, emblems and emblems of arms of the surname Hashanova

Traditionally, the coat of arms is awarded to a specific individual with the surname Hashanova, without extending to all those who bear the name Hashanova. The right to use a particular coat of arms is passed down in accordance with the laws and customs of heraldry, which implies that not all individuals with the surname Hashanova have the heraldic right to use the coat of arms associated with their ancestors.

The emblematic emblem of Hashanova

The emblematic badge, or coat of arms of Hashanova, is a singular representation that includes a variety of elements, such as a blazon with specific shapes, tones (tints), and often exterior decorations that denote the status or title of the person who wears it. flaunts The components of the emblematic emblem of Hashanova are arranged following the precise rules of heraldry, and each part has a unique significance. Colors, symbols (charges), and designs (divisions and borders) mix to form a symbol that is both an artistic expression and an identification system.
